Вопрос или проблема
У меня есть список веб-ссылок в таблице Power BI. Как сделать так, чтобы при клике на ссылку она открывалась только в Edge? Я не хочу устанавливать браузер по умолчанию, потому что кто-то может захотеть посмотреть отчет в Chrome или Firefox, но эти веб-ссылки работают только в Microsoft Edge. Пожалуйста, помогите, как это сделать.
Я просто использую синтаксис microsoft-edge:https://weblink, но не могу установить его как URL-адрес.
Ответ или решение
Чтобы обеспечить открытие веб-ссылок в Microsoft Edge из Power BI, не изменяя при этом настройку браузера по умолчанию, можно использовать подход с явным указанием префикса microsoft-edge:
в ссылках. Этот метод позволит вам открывать указанные веб-страницы именно в Edge, независимо от того, какой браузер установлен по умолчанию.
1. Подготовка данных в Power BI
Первым шагом будет подготовка ваших данных. Убедитесь, что в вашей таблице Power BI у вас есть столбец с адресами веб-сайтов. Вам нужно будет отредактировать эти ссылки, добавив префикс microsoft-edge:
.
2. Добавление префикса в URL
В Power BI можно использовать DAX для создания нового столбца, который будет содержать ссылки с указанным префиксом. Например, если у вас есть столбец WebLink
, можно создать новый столбец следующим образом:
EdgeLink = "microsoft-edge:" & [WebLink]
3. Настройка кнопки для открытия ссылки
После того как вы создали новый столбец с сгенерированными ссылками, вам нужно настроить отображение этих ссылок в вашем отчете. Вы можете использовать визуализацию, такую как таблица или карточка, чтобы отображать ваши ссылки.
3.1 Использование кнопки "URL"
Вы можете добавить кнопку или элемент управления, который будет реагировать на клики по вашим ссылкам. Для этого:
- Перейдите в режим редактирования отчета.
- Добавьте элемент "Кнопка" или другой элемент управления, который поддерживает действие перехода по URL.
- В свойствах этого элемента управления укажите ваш новый столбец
EdgeLink
.
4. Настройка взаимодействия
Убедитесь, что в настройках визуализации ваше поле ссылок настроено как взаимодействующее значение. Это обеспечит корректное срабатывание перехода по ссылке при клике.
5. Тестирование
Не забудьте протестировать работу созданного решения. Откройте отчет и кликните по ссылке, чтобы убедиться, что она корректно открывается в Microsoft Edge.
Заключение
Используя указанный метод с добавлением префикса microsoft-edge:
, вы сможете эффективно открывать ссылки в Microsoft Edge из Power BI, не изменяя настройки браузера по умолчанию для всего устройства. Это обходит ограничения, связанные с браузерами, и позволяет каждому пользователю работать в привычной среде, получая доступ к необходимым ресурсам.
Если у вас возникнут дополнительные вопросы или понадобятся уточнения по реализации, не стесняйтесь обращаться за помощью!